NEW YORK – With the regular season complete and the 2017 BIG EAST Softball Championship presented by Jeep two days away, the Conference announced its annual award winners and All-BIG EAST Teams on Wednesday.
For a second consecutive year, Villanova boasted the BIG EAST Pitcher of the Year as senior Brette Lawrence garnered the honors, while Seton Hall’s Alexis Walkden was named BIG EAST Player of the Year and DePaul’s Jessica Cothern was selected BIG EAST Freshman of the Year. Top-seeded St. John’s and head coach Amy Kvilhaug rounded out the major awards by nabbing BIG EAST Coaching Staff of the Year.
A dependable hurler for the Wildcats, Lawrence capped off her senior season throwing a league-high 88.2 innings while recording a BIG EAST-best 10 wins in the circle. The Wildcat was selected BIG EAST Pitcher of the Week twice this season and was the only pitcher in the league to be recognized as the Louisville Slugger NFCA National Division I Pitcher of the Week. Overall, Lawrence ranks 29th in the NCAA in strikeouts with 184, including a league-best 85 posted in BIG EAST play.
Hot at the plate for Seton Hall, Walkden is the first Pirate to be honored as the BIG EAST Player of the Year since Lauren Taylor in 2005. Batting a team-best .373, the junior third baseman led SHU with 22 hits, 21 runs batted in, 15 runs scored and a conference-best .814 slugging percentage. She also tied for a league-best 48 total bases while ranking second in the BIG EAST in walks (21) and home runs (7).
A true freshman for DePaul, Cothern led all rookies with a .452 batting average and a conference-high 28 hits. The catcher ranked second on the DePaul roster in batting average, knocking in 14 runs behind four homers and three doubles. Cothern also helped the Blue Demons to a .949 fielding percentage with 100 putouts.
Kvilhaug led the Red Storm to their second BIG EAST regular-season title in the last three years with a team-record 17 league wins. The Johnnies last won the title in 2015 with 16 conference wins. As a team, St. John’s topped the league in batting average at .350 in conference games. St. John’s also led the BIG EAST with 307 total bases, 207 hits, 157 runs scored, 140 RBI and 38 stolen bases. In the circle, the Red Storm paced the league with 135 strike outs and showed the conference’s second-lowest earned run average at 3.14.
Each All-BIG EAST Team consists of 12 players: two pitchers, one catcher, first baseman, second baseman, short stop, third baseman, utility/pitcher, designated player/non-pitcher and three outfielders. St. John’s led all teams with seven all-league selections including four first-team honorees.
DePaul also put four players on the first team while Villanova collected a pair first-team nods and two second-team selections. Creighton and Providence each added three total picks, including one first-team honor for the Bluejays. Butler had pair of second-team honors while Seton Hall claimed a first-team selection in Walkden. Walkden, Villanova first baseman Nikki Alden, St. John’s second baseman Lexi Robles and outfielder Lauren Zick were unanimous All-BIG EAST First Team selections.
BIG EAST Championship teams combined for 17 of the 24 All-BIG EAST selections.
